Job description

We are a private‑equity‑backed manufacturing and distribution company with approximately $90 million in annual revenue. The company operates in a multi‑location environment.

Position Summary

The Corporate Controller is responsible for all accounting operations, financial close and reporting, internal controls, and technical accounting. This role partners closely with the CFO, executive leadership, and the private‑equity sponsor to ensure timely, accurate, decision‑useful financial information and to support value creation through organic growth and add‑on acquisitions.

Key Responsibilities
  • Own and lead monthly, quarterly, and annual close processes for the consolidated company including all general ledger activity and account reconciliations.
  • Prepare GAAP‑compliant financial statements and management reporting packages for leadership, lenders, and private‑equity sponsors with support from Director FP&A.
  • Support the review of standard costing, variance analysis, inventory reserves, and overhead absorption.
  • Maintain robust internal controls and serve as primary accounting lead for annual financial audits.
  • Lead, develop, and scale the accounting team while driving process, controls, and ERP improvements.
  • Develop and implement financial policies.
  • Support the preparation of corporate and state tax returns.
  • Oversee accounts payable and accounts receivable functions with three direct reports: assistant controller, AP and AR analysts.
Add‑On Acquisition Integration Responsibilities
  • Serve as accounting lead during financial due diligence for add‑on acquisitions, supporting data requests, quality of earnings analysis, and assessment of accounting risks.
  • Develop and execute post‑close accounting integration plans in coordination with the CFO, operations, IT, and private‑equity sponsor.
  • Align acquired entities to company accounting policies, chart of accounts, close calendar, and internal control standards.
  • Assess and remediate gaps in accounting processes, controls, and financial reporting at acquired businesses.
  • Lead integration of acquired entities into the company’s ERP and reporting systems, including data mapping, opening balance sheets, and historical data conversion.
  • Ensure accurate purchase accounting, including opening balance sheet adjustments, inventory valuation, and working capital normalization.
  • Standardize cost accounting methodologies across legacy and acquired businesses to ensure consistent margin and performance reporting.
  • Coordinate with external auditors and advisors on acquisition‑related accounting matters and audit requirements.
  • Support leadership with integration status reporting, synergy tracking, and identification of accounting‑driven value‑creation opportunities.
  • Establish scalable integration playbooks and repeatable processes to support future add‑on acquisitions.
